soc: microchip: add mpfs gpio interrupt mux driver

On PolarFire SoC there are more GPIO interrupts than there are interrupt
lines available on the PLIC, and a runtime configurable mux is used to
decide which interrupts are assigned direct connections to the PLIC &
which are relegated to sharing a line.

Add a driver so that Linux can set the mux based on the interrupt
mapping in the devicetree.

soc: microchip: add mfd drivers for two syscon regions on PolarFire SoC

The control-scb and mss-top-sysreg regions on PolarFire SoC both fulfill
multiple purposes. The former is used for mailbox functions in addition
to the temperature & voltage sensor while the latter is used for clocks,
resets, interrupt muxing and pinctrl.
